Why I Added GPIQ: Income, Stability, Quality - And Outperformance

Why I Added GPIQ: Income, Stability, Quality - And Outperformance

I added Goldman Sachs Nasdaq-100 Premium Income ETF to my all-income portfolio for its stability, low expense ratio, and strong NAV growth. GPIQ outperformed peers in price over the past year despite a lower yield, supported by an options strategy covering 25–75% of the portfolio. The fund offers stable monthly distributions, averaging $0.42/share, with a tax-favorable return of capital composition ideal for taxable accounts.

GPIQ: Simplifying The Game For Retirees Seeking Income Generation

GPIQ: Simplifying The Game For Retirees Seeking Income Generation

Goldman Sachs Nasdaq-100 Premium Income ETF offers retirees a compelling blend of high yield (9.4%) and exposure to top Nasdaq-100 companies. GPIQ employs a dynamic option writing strategy, balancing income generation with participation in market rallies, while limiting downside from interest rate or credit risk. Although GPIQ underperforms traditional index ETFs like QQQ in total return, its monthly payouts are stable and tax-efficient, appealing to income-focused investors.

Overview

Our company operates a specialized investment fund that focuses primarily on equity investments. We allocate at least 80% of our net assets, along with any borrowings intended for investment purposes, into equities that are part of our fund’s benchmark. By adhering closely to the style, capitalization, and industry characteristics of our benchmark, we aim to replicate its performance. Our strategy is finely tuned to investors looking for focused exposure rather than diversification, as our fund operates with a non-diversified status. This approach caters to investors seeking to capitalize on the growth and potential of specific sectors represented in our benchmark.
